THANKSGIVING DAY CELEBRATION

11/6/2018

0 Comments

 
​Our nation will celebrate Thanksgiving Day on Thursday, November 22nd.  On that day, we will have our Thanksgiving Day Mass at 8:00am in Church.
 
Every day we are to give thanks and praise to Almighty God.  And just what are we to be thankful for at this point in our lives?  Are we thankful that our region has so far been spared from a major storm this hurricane season?  Are you thankful for your faith?  Life is not always good or perfect but we can surely find something to be thankful for?  I can assure you, we have much to be thankful for.  That is why it is necessary and important that we pray in thanksgiving and pray to foster a spirit of gratitude. 
 
I hope and pray that this Thanksgiving Holiday bless you and your loved ones with abundant grace filled blessings.  May each of you and your loved ones have a peaceful Thanksgiving Holiday. 
 
Thanks be to God for His love and mercy!
